  1. Type II diabetes mellitus

    Plant part used: Sheet.

    Scientific references (short excerpts)

    Short excerpts only (not the full article). Full reference records are in the Lapo v2 application.

    • According to Hamiduzzaman Md (2013)

      Excerpt Focused on traditional medicinal practice of Gomphrenal globosa (L), my present study was to scientifically evaluate the hypoglycemic activity in mice model which could give us a new voyage to prevent or treat diabetic patients with harmless natural resources. Gomphrena globosa (L) is a member of Amaranthaceae family was collected & partitioned into n-Hexane Soluble Fraction, Chloroform Soluble Fraction, Carbon tetrachloride Soluble Fraction & aqueous Soluble Fraction.

    • According to Omodamiro OD (2014)

      Excerpt In conclusion, the ethanolic extract of the leaves of GG & AO possess hypoglyceamic activity in alloxan induced diabetic wistar albino rat. w.) produced a dose-dependant significant reduction (p<0.05) in blood glucose levels of fasted alloxan induced diabetic rat after 1-3 days compared to control.

    • According to Sherif ATY (2021)

      Excerpt The ethanolic leaf extract exerted its antidiabetic effect by inhibiting the activity of α-amylase (p<0.05) resulting in the delayed digestion of the dietary carbohydrates and lowering the amount of glucose liberated. The aim of this study was to evaluate the antidiabetic, antioxidant & antiglycation activity of ethanolic leaf extract of G.

  2. Bacterial infection: Bacillus cereus, Escherichia coli, Listeria monocytogenes, Staphylococcus aureus, Pseudomonas aeruginosa, Salmonella typhi and Shigella dysenteriae

    Plant part used: Flower.

    Scientific references (short excerpts)

    Short excerpts only (not the full article). Full reference records are in the Lapo v2 application.

    • According to Kusmiati K (2017)

      Excerpt The condensed extracts were tested for antimicrobial activity against Escherichia coli, Staphylococcus aureus, Pseudomonas aeruginosa, & Shigella dysenteriae. Objective of the study was to identify the highest antimicrobial activity of GG flower extract using ethanol, petroleum ether, ethyl acetate & n-butanol solvents.

    • According to Roriz Custodio.Lobo (2018)

      Excerpt To enhance the antimicrobial (Bacillus cereus, Listeria monocytogenes, Escherichia coli & Salmonella typhimurium) & antifungal (Aspergillus flavus, Aspergillus niger, Penicillium ochrochloron & Penicillium verrucosum) activities, the responses were evaluated in terms of the concentrations needed to obtain minimum inhibitory (MIC), minimum bactericidal (MBC) & minimum fungicidal (MFC) concentrations. In conclusion, the results obtained in this study highlight extracts from GG flowers as natural sources of betacyanins with application as food colorants with important antimicrobial & antifungal activities.

    • According to Sporna-Kucab A (2018)

      Excerpt High-speed counter-current chromatography (HSCCC) combined with HPLC were established to purify, for the first time, betacyanin isomers from Gomphrena globosa L. The isolated compounds showed a broad antimicrobial spectrum (in the range of 0.19-1.5 mg mL-1) by inhibiting the growth of all of food-borne pathogens tested.

    • According to Jesse Joel T (2019)

      Excerpt Escherichia coli was used to test for antibacterial efficacy. Betacyanin were extracted from Gomphrena globosa l.

  3. Osteoarthritis, arthritis, rheumatism, oedema

    Plant part used: Flower.

    Scientific references (short excerpts)

    Short excerpts only (not the full article). Full reference records are in the Lapo v2 application.

    • According to Esmat UA (2020)

      Excerpt These phytochemicals recognised are responsible for various activities such as anti-inflammatory, anticancer, antibacterial, analgesic & cytotoxic. The major bioactive compounds are Docosanoic Acid, Docosyl Ester (25.404%) & Hexatriacontane (24.324%), has proven anti-inflammatory activity.

    • According to Arsia Tarnam Y (2021)

      Excerpt Decoction & hydroalcoholic flower extracts (pink varieties) of GG was evaluated for its anti-inflammatory activity. Earlier reports have showed that the compound 1, 2-benzene-dicarboxylic acid, bis (2-ethylhexyl) ester possess antioxidant & anti-inflammatory activity.

    • According to ---Silva LR (2012)

      Excerpt The data provide evidence of the GG inflorescences potential as a source of anti-inflammatory compounds, with relevance for the treatment of acute or chronic inflammatory conditions, & health-promoting antioxidants for use by both food & pharmaceutical industries.
